Activate your mental fitness now with these 5 tips!




Here are five strategies to enhance your mental fitness:


  1. Mindfulness and Meditation: Incorporate mindfulness and meditation practices into your daily routine. These techniques help you stay present, reduce stress, and improve your overall mental well-being. Start with short sessions and gradually increase the duration as you become more comfortable.

  2. Regular Exercise: Physical activity has a profound impact on mental health. Regular exercise releases endorphins, which are natural mood lifters. Aim for at least 30 minutes of moderate exercise most days of the week. Find an activity you enjoy, whether it's jogging, swimming, yoga, or dancing.

  3. Balanced Nutrition: Eat a well-balanced diet that includes a variety of nutrients. Certain nutrients, such as omega-3 fatty acids, vitamins, and minerals, play a crucial role in brain function. Avoid excessive consumption of processed foods, sugars, and caffeine, as they can affect mood and energy levels.

  4. Adequate Sleep: Prioritize good sleep hygiene. Aim for 7-9 hours of quality sleep each night. Create a relaxing bedtime routine, keep your sleep environment comfortable, and avoid screens before bedtime. Quality sleep is essential for cognitive function, mood regulation, and overall mental health.

  5. Cultivate Positive Relationships: Nurture positive and supportive relationships. Surround yourself with people who uplift and encourage you. Social connections provide emotional support, reduce feelings of loneliness, and contribute to a sense of belonging. Make an effort to spend time with loved ones and engage in meaningful social activities.

Remember that mental fitness is a holistic concept, and individual needs may vary. It's essential to listen to your body and mind, be proactive in self-care, and seek professional help if you're struggling with persistent mental health challenges.
